WebAutothermal reforming(ATR) combines the steam reforming reaction and fuel oxidation into a single unit, the exothermic oxidation providing the heat for the endothermic reforming process. ATR is popular for smallerscale hydrogen generation and affords higher H2production than POX and faster start-up and response times than steam reforming. WebSteam methane reforming (SMR), or simply known as steam reforming, is the standard industrial method of producing commercial bulk hydrogen gas. More than 50 million metric tons are produced annually worldwide (2013), principally from the SMR of natural gas.
